Output 2df112c4d03efdffb0b755948d2e80d5438415200b5ef1e454ade23faa7d3e5e:1

value
180676577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37556bc90120add8890d596db88a6e924eece888 OP_EQUAL
address
36jbRFa937hyLmB7oEFhF6QrB9cMB9sgXm
transaction
2df112c4d03efdffb0b755948d2e80d5438415200b5ef1e454ade23faa7d3e5e
confirmations
371404
spent
true